Walter Gorton Berry Jr. died May 31, 2019 at the age of 68. Walter was born in Memphis, TN June 21, 1950 where he spent his early years. He moved to Birmingham and attended Mountain Brook Schools until moving to Huntsville, AL where he graduated from Huntsville High School in 1968. He served in...
